About Us: Forza Silicon is a Business Unit in the Materials Analysis Division of AMETEK, Inc. Forza’s history begins at the formation of the CMOS imaging industry where company co-founders, Barmak Mansoorian and Daniel Van Blerkom were a critical part of the Photobit team. Along with Photobit Co-founder, Dr. Eric Fossum, and many others, the team pioneered the development of CMOS imaging technology. Founded in 2001, Forza Silicon has established itself as an innovator and industry leader in the field of mixed-signal IC and CMOS imaging designs that have set the standard of the possible.
